User:keiransgku976266
Jump to navigation
Jump to search
Elevate your merchandise with the timeless appeal of crafted wood retail display stands. These sturdy stands perfectly showcase your treasures, attracting attention and enticing customers.
https://maheradadaprinting.net/printing-displays/